American missionary accuses Benue government of attempting to sabotage his plans of rebuilding Yelwata village which was attacked by bandits

An American missionary has accused the Benue State Government of deliberately obstructing his efforts to rebuild Yelwata village, which was recently attacked by bandits.

 

 

According to him, he attempted to construct a market for the people of Yelwata, but the government rejected the proposal and instead sent him a market blueprint valued at ₦300 million. He insists the project can be completed for no more than ₦60 million.

 

 

He also claimed that there’s no market in any Nigerian village that is worth N300m.

 

 

The missionary further alleged that certain individuals are exploiting the suffering of Benue indigenes affected by bandit attacks for personal gain..
